New Podcast Episode: The Murder of Girly Chew Hossencofft

Twenty three years ago today, 36 year old Girly Chew Hossencofft was murdered by her estranged husband, Diazien Hossencofft, and his girlfriend, Linda Henning. Girly Chew met Diazien during one of several trips to the United States from her home country of Malaysia in the early 1990s. After immigrating to marry and start a new life with Hossencofft, Girly's life in America wasn't what she had anticipated.

The four Archetypes of Serial Killers

Harold Schester, an American true crime writer, examined serial killers, their victims, and their motives by separating them into four categories in his book The A to Z Encyclopedia of Serial Killers.

According to Schester, there is no clear-cut definition or recipe for a serial killer, but it is possible to divide them into four archetypes: power & control, visionary, missionary, and hedonistic. Here are the descriptions.

What is Wicca? Who are the Practitioners?

Wicca is an alternative minority religion that began in the U.K. in the 1940s as a pagan movement. The movement arrived in the United States in the 1960s. Unlike the bad reputation of Witchcraft in history, Wicca is not satanic and demonic; it's a 'pre-Christian tradition' that promotes divinity that is sought in nature.
